Everyone already knows for sure the story that the requirements for engine displacement for "Dakar" racing trucks were constantly changing and it was decided to limit them at 13 liters (now 16-liter ones can be used). KAMAZ-master began to test several different variants of engines with such displacement, and eventually settled on 13-liter American Cummins QSZ13 engines assembled under license ... in China. When we were at the team's base in December 2016, we just caught the moment when on motor stand tested such a unit.

About gas-fueled KAMAZ The refurbished EcoGas sports truck is equipped with new engine, the working volume of which is 16 liters. This is 2.3 liters less than the previous version of the car. Despite the fact that the maximum power of the truck was reduced by 5%, the torque remained at the same level - 4000 Nm. The gas-diesel engine is turbocharged with intercooled air, which increases engine power while reducing fuel consumption by increasing the amount of air supplied to the cylinders. Has undergone modernization and gas equipment sports KAMAZ: on new version equipment of the third generation was installed, which made it possible to reduce the total weight of the car. Fuel The truck is equipped with four 89-liter cylinders of the Polish company Stako with EcoGas fuel. In total, they hold 80 cubic meters of natural gas, which is enough for a race for about 340-350 km. The cylinders are made of aluminum (5 mm thick), outside - composite materials (Kevlar) 10 mm thick. One empty cylinder weighs 35 kg. The main fuel tank holds 1000 liters of diesel fuel. The vehicle has a range of almost 1,500 km, which is 500 km more when using only diesel fuel. When operating in the gas-diesel cycle, the fuel mixture consists of 70% diesel and 30% EcoGas supplied to the intake manifold. Since the ignition temperature of natural gas is almost twice as high as that of a diesel engine, an air-gas mixture is first fed into the combustion chamber at the intake stroke, which ignites at the end of the compression stroke, at the moment of injection of the main (so-called ignition) portion of diesel fuel. This scheme has a number of advantages. When natural gas runs out, the engine continues to run as usual, that is, exclusively on diesel fuel... And unlike converted to work only on gas diesel engines, there is no need to remove the standard fuel equipment and replace it with an ignition system with candles instead of injectors.

Let me remind you that in 2012, the V8 TMZ-7E846.10 engine (Tutaevsky Motor Plant), with a working volume of 18.5 liters, with a capacity of 850 hp, was used for the last time on top-end KAMAZ-master trucks. and with a torque of 2700 Nm, with a curb weight of the truck of 9300 kg. The team liked the engine, it was reliable, albeit outdated.

Characteristics of the TMZ-7E846.10 engine

Engine type: diesel, 8-cylinder, 4-stroke with V-shaped arrangement of cylinders (camber angle 90 °), direction of rotation crankshaft- right, with turbocharging, with intercooling of charge air. The cylinder diameter is 140 mm, the piston stroke is 140 mm. The cooling system is liquid, the water-oil radiator is built into the engine. Installed on: Engine for sports cars "KamAZ-Master" and "MAZ-SPORT" participating in rally-raids.

Since 2013, the technical requirements have changed. The maximum working volume was not to exceed 16 liters. Then an option was found with the Swiss-German tractor power unit Liebherr D9508 V8. Moreover, its refinement to racing conditions was carried out directly in Naberezhnye Chelny, on the basis of the team. As a result, the official characteristics of KAMAZ 4326 with it are as follows: a working volume of 16 liters, a power of 920 hp, a torque of 4000 Nm, with a curb weight of the car of 8900 kg. Although, according to the employees of the team, they had to suffer with "Liebherr", and at first it did not suit its reliability, but then they were able to bring it to the required condition. And again the team from Tatarstan began to win, although it became more and more difficult to do it, the character of the track in “Dakar” also changed, towards simplification. In 2016, the first place was lost, but already in 2017, Chelny residents were able to return to the top and win again!

In the meantime, the organizers of the "Dakar" decided to again limit the volume of engines for the 2017 race, this time - no more than 16 liters. The team again had to invest in redesigning the Liebherr engine so that the reduction in displacement did not significantly affect performance. The next step - it was decided to allow trucks with a maximum of 13-liter power units... In this case, it turns out to be overboard Liebherr, in the revision of which more than one million dollars were invested. What cars are participating in the Dakar?

Especially for the rally-raid "Dakar" trucks undergo brutal upgrades to survive the tough desert races. The car must be strong, so as not to fall apart from the next jump from the springboard and hardy, in order to pass 500-700 kilometers a day on the sultry sands of the "Dakar". All repairs are in progress on their own, because of this, the crew of the combat vehicle includes, in addition to the driver and navigator, a mechanic.

Let's analyze technical device KamAZ "4911-EXTREME", which is the prototype of the racing car for the Dakar. The engine is a unit from the Yaroslavl Motor Plant, which is equipped with two turbochargers and a cooling system for the supplied air. The maximum power is 730 hp. and the "unreal" 2700 "newtons" of torque.

Those who think they are technical specifications engine needed for maximum speed - wrong. Indeed, in the rally-raids "Dakar" maximum speed of participating cars is of little importance, and in some sections it is completely limited to 150 km / h. The most important thing is the torque needed to overcome quicksand so that the car does not get stuck in them.

Another interesting feature of KamAZ "4911-EXTREME" is that the body is rigidly attached to the frame, and the seats are rigidly attached to the body. There is little comfort from such a solution, but this feature helps the pilot to feel all the nuances of the race car's behavior and, accordingly, quickly respond to any changes. Besides, racing cars They are distinguished by the presence of additional headlights, sports seats, and the presence of an electric winch.

Currently, the KamAZ-Master team uses the prototype KAMAZ 4326 (4x4), which participates in the Dakar rally-raids to this day.

The reason for the creation of KAMAZ 4326 was the next change in the requirements from the FIA, which made it possible to make sport car based on serial components and assemblies. He has an eight-cylinder engine with an output of 830 hp. The engine has been moved 400 mm and the cab has been moved 200 mm towards the rear axle. This made it possible to improve the "weight distribution" of the truck.

By reducing the front overhang, the geometric cross-country ability has improved. The car's ride has become smoother due to the modernization of the suspension, in particular the use of new shock absorbers. The weight of the truck was reduced, although it was not possible to reach the permitted minimum limit of 8.5 tons.

In September 1988, the team from Naberezhnye Chelny made its debut at the Yelch rally in Poland. In that first rally-raid in its history, KAMAZ athletes performed on serial four-wheel drive SUVs KAMAZ 4310 ... Already in the early 90s, in close collaboration with the factory designers and testers, the team created their own sports trucks: KAMAZ 49250 and KAMAZ 49251 ... The basis for these machines was the most advanced technology of the Kama Automobile Plant at that time.

In 1994, the team took part in a car with pronounced sports characteristics, which are fundamentally different from ordinary production trucks - KAMAZ 49252 ... It had a 750 horsepower engine, a mid-engined layout and large 25-inch wheels. The sloping platform of the SUV, designed to reduce aerodynamic drag, is an original stage in the design of a sports truck that has gone down in history. In a year, three new generation sports trucks will carry the KAMAZ crews to the victorious podium of the Paris-Moscow-Beijing auto marathon. A few months later, in January 1996, the team became the winner of the legendary Dakar rally-marathon for the first time.

Experiments on technique were sometimes a little too daring. For example, sports KAMAZ 49255 had a twelve-cylinder engine with a capacity of 1050 horsepower. His hyper-powerful heart broke the transmission, which happened at the 1998 Dakar. Very often, cars were born in the shortest possible time. So, in 2002, the FIA ​​vetoed the participation in the Dakar of trucks with a mid-engined line-up, which provides good weight distribution and stability. The Kamaz truck was just that. But the biggest difficulty was that these innovations became known only six months before the start. In a short time, a combat sports truck was created KAMAZ 49256 with an 830 horsepower engine. He was born in agony, after each test the car was taken from the landfill on a trawl. And only a few hours before the command was sent to the Dakar, the error was found and eliminated. As a result, the car passed the test of durability, bringing KAMAZ another Dakar gold.

A year later, the KAMAZ-master team made a new qualitative leap, creating new model sports car. KAMAZ 4911 EXTREME became a combat vehicle unparalleled in cross-country ability, maneuverability and dynamics. For its unique technical and operational qualities, it was named "the flying truck". Indeed, in the hands of such masters as the pilot Vladimir Chagin, this car at speed easily lifted off the ground, pushing off natural jumps. With an 830 horsepower engine, the car accelerated to 100 km / h in ten seconds.

Since 1999, the rally "Desert Challenge" in the United Arab Emirates has become a traditional testing ground for technical innovations, the conditions of which are as close as possible to those of Dakar. The team began to constantly work to reduce the weight of the car, increase the smoothness of the ride and solve many other important tasks to improve the technology.

In 2007, the organizers of the "Dakar" again changed technical requirements presented to the trucks participating in the race, softening them somewhat. In particular, it became possible to shift the engine back a little, which the KAMAZ-master team took advantage of, improving the weight distribution and maneuverability of the car, as well as increasing the smoothness of the ride. However, the relief in one led to a tightening in the other: new requirements for serial production were introduced. If earlier, in order for a sports truck to pass homologation, it was enough to release fifteen such cars from the assembly line, now it took fifty over two years. Therefore, again, a car produced by the Kama auto giant for the needs of the army was taken as the basis for the new model.

At the end of 2007 was born KAMAZ-4326 VK ... Only one fact testifies to the conscientiousness of the approach to the creation of the vehicle: the new KAMAZ combat truck was the first to undergo homologation in its class. The pre-jubilee KAMAZ-4326 VK, which embodied all the best practices of the team, proved its potential first at the stages of the Russian Championship, and then at the Dakar 2009.

In 2016, the KAMAZ-master team presented a sports truck with a bonnet configuration. Decision to create new car was adopted on the basis of the growing trend for the use of bonnet vehicles in the off-road sports discipline.

KAMAZ for Dakar really has little in common with its serial counterparts. The frame and cabin here are, of course, domestic, from the military "two-axle" 4326, but the sports engineers had to thoroughly redraw the cabin in order to shift it back as much as possible for better weight distribution, and reinforce the frame many times over. And even outwardly, the "combat" truck does not look like a "civilian" one! In production models, the headlights are located on the bumper, while in the sports version, small xenon "eyes" have settled on the front end, under the windshield. Some of the cars do come out with old "big-eyed" cabins.

There are rumors that the next generation of sports camions (in rally-raids it is customary to call trucks with the French word) will receive a cab from the newest KAMAZ-5490 mainline tractor, but there is no reason to be proud: this cab is entirely taken from Mercedes-Benz Axor ... So it's better to keep the existing authentic look. And to return the powerful structure of steel pipes, on which the "chandelier" of six spotlights was hung! A modest arc holding four LED sections of additional lighting equipment deprived the racing KAMAZ of its deliberately aggressive appearance.

But the main disappointment from the current version of KAMAZ-4326 is the new engines. They are Swiss, Liebherr brands! Two of the five cars are still equipped with the proven V-shaped "eight" YaMZ (880 hp and 3600 Nm), but this unit has no future. The 18.5-liter giant barely fits into the existing smoke standards, and by the next edition of the marathon it will have to be retired completely - the organizers of the rally-raid will forcibly limit the volume of engines. That is why Anton Shibalov went to the Dakar-2014 awards ceremony with a quiet grumble, and not with the famous powerful roar of the Yaroslavl diesel engine - Liebherr was already installed on his truck.

What can you be proud of? The gearboxes on the cars of the blue-and-white squad have long been imported - German ZF. (however, exactly the same ones are put on serial products from Naberezhnye Chelny). The distribution is also overseas, brand Steyr. The bridges are supplied by the Finnish company Sisu, and the uncompromisingly rigid suspension from the Russian BMD (airborne combat vehicle) had to be replaced with Dutch Reiger struts, as soon as the crews no longer had enough "safety margin": with such a "hover" KAMAZ flew giant potholes without shuddering, but the riders were shaking mercilessly, so many have developed serious health problems ...

Tires, steering gear, clutch and brake system- all this is also imported. Is that the brake drums are native, KAMAZ. However, the latter were left rather out of despair: they wanted to switch to disk mechanisms from a renowned European company, but they overheated too quickly. There is no need to talk about the insides of the cabin either: virtually nothing remained of the production car, including the speedometer, which is marked here up to 200 km / h. But the racing KAMAZ accelerates to a maximum of 180, consuming up to 150 l / 100 km, and in the race, the maximum speed is completely limited to 150 km / h.

It turns out that the "combat" KAMAZ-4326 not only does not look like serial equipment, but also almost entirely consists of imported components! But there is one "but". Anyone can buy a Liebherr engine, ZF gearbox, Steyr transfer case, Sisu axles and Reiger suspension and put it on a military or construction truck. And only KAMAZ wins Dakar. Another excuse: the rivals' cars are also far from standard ... Do you think that IVECO, which took second place at the current Dakar, is almost a serial truck, as the team's PR specialists position it?

Not at all! This is the same prefabricated hodgepodge of units from different manufacturers. Moreover, IVECO has nothing to do with the creation of a racing truck: it was built by the private sports team Team De Rooy - that is, the de Rooy family stable. And that is why Gerard's car is so different from others. Which, however, can be clearly seen from the photographs. All other machines are cabover-free and are based on the aggregates of the Trakker construction dump truck, and the leader of the team has built a "bonnet" for himself.

This, by the way, causes a certain dissatisfaction with the head office of IVECO, which wants the truck, which most often gets into the sights of the cameras, to look like mass models like the aforementioned Trucker. And so Ivekov's PR specialists had to come up with a legend that the "nosed" car was a sports version of the heavyweight Powerstar, a model for the Australian market. Although the carbon fiber hood only imitates the appearance of the overseas prototype, and the cockpit is taken from the long-range IVECO Stralis. But while such a car wins, the bosses of the brand have nowhere to go.

Actually, the racing success of the "bonnet" is largely due to the layout - the car boasts an ideal "50 to 50" weight distribution along the axles. What does it do? First, the "nosed" car jumps and lands a priori better than competitors in which the cabin is located above the engine. Secondly, the crew does not sit “on the wheel”, which makes it possible to reduce shock loads and, consequently, to fly over obstacles at a higher speed. Those potholes that the crew of a sports KAMAZ overcomes, risking their health, Ivek residents do not notice at all ...

Continuing the topic of overcoming obstacles, we note that Gerard is a big fan of experiments on the suspension. Once he tried to transfer his camion to an independent circuit, and now he uses Donnere shock absorbers, which are rare for Dakar vehicles, although most competitors (including KAMAZ-master) choose Dutch Reiger Racing. However, most likely, the French pendants simply offered Deroy's stable more interesting conditions than their fellow Dutchmen. Springs from cargo off-road vehicles Astra.

By the way, from Astr (this is a subsidiary of the IVECO concern, which is engaged in the production of military and super-heavy trucks), bridges are used on cabover IVECOs. But on the bonnet car, the axles are different, of the Finnish Sisu brand: the team believes that the Finnish transmission components are lighter and more reliable than the Ivek ones. Also, the Dutch are sure that disc brakes are better than standard drum brakes - all turquoise camions, regardless of the brand of axles, are equipped with Knorr-Bremse ventilated disc mechanisms! Although other cargo stables find the good old "drums" more suitable for the harsh conditions of Dakar - they overheat less and the mechanism itself is closed to dirt.

The rest of the racing IVECOs are very similar to their serial counterparts. Taken from Trakker Steyr transfer case, 16-speed ZF gearbox and ... even the engine! This is an in-line "six" of the Cursor family with a volume of 12.9 liters, however, pretty forced. If the most powerful of the IVECO construction trucks develops 500 hp. and 2300 Nm, the diesel of a sports truck produces 900 hp. maximum power, and the maximum torque is a fantastic 3800 Nm.

Does it even make sense to look for similarities between sports and road trucks? As it turned out, there is: a trinity of cabover IVECOs (the best of which, under the control of Hans Stacy, took 7th place at the last Dakar), with the exception of the suspension, was really built from units of production cars. But Deroev's "bonnet" is one hundred percent homemade, just stylized as a mass model and assembled from components that, according to Gerard, are the lightest, strongest and most reliable today.

But it makes no sense to compare racing and serial KAMAZ. There is almost nothing in common between them ... Behind the Russian emblem are foreign units, albeit intelligently assembled by our engineers. New trucks from Naberezhnye Chelny are becoming such now: a Mercedes-Benz cab, a Cummins engine, and a ZF gearbox are installed on the domestic frame. So while the country cannot be proud of ordinary trucks, let's be proud of the racing ones - the "combat" vehicles do their job perfectly, confidently stamping victory after victory.
